Inappropriate cheers from the Perry County Central/Pikeville basketball game


Recommended Posts

There were reports in the game thread of some questionable cheers coming from the student sections towards the end of the game. I wasn't there, so I can't say for sure what all was said, and what actions were taken to stop the cheers...but I'm interested to hear people's thoughts on this one.

 

 

From @PurplePride92:

 

PCC student section chanting "has no class" to Pikeville.

 

From @Wireman:

It's not cool to chant USA or Nigeria at foreign players. Where is the administration?

 

 

I also saw tweets from Josh Moore of the Herald-Leader saying:

 

PCC students chanring "Have some class!" @ Pikeville students, who have broken out in "USA! USA!" chants as PCC's foreign players shoot FTs.

 

Perry Central students now chanting "Nigeria! Nigeria!"
